    Seems like the Stomp XL is the same as a POD GO in terms of DSP but with a degraded interface and no expression pedal. I'm not sure why a person would take one of these compared with a slightly cheaper Pod GO.
    I wish Line 6 would take the full DSP processing power of the Helix and put it in the Pod GO form factor and call it something better so that it's more obviously in the HX family.

    • @michaelseebass
      @michaelseebass  Рік тому

      I don't own the Pod GO but as far as I know on the Pod GO the effects chain is fixed, meaning there are designated slots where you can use certain effects. For example at the start you have your wha slot, and while you can turn it off, you can't remove it. Same would probably go for other blocks, if you want to do anything special it's probably not as easy on the Pod GO. Also from what I recall there is a small number of effect models that are not available on the Pod Go. I might be wrong, Pod Go users feel free to correct me. Essentially if you need more flexibility the Stomp is good. The Pod Go is more of a "ready to go" all in one package without too much in depth flexibility

    • @SirTupsAlot
      @SirTupsAlot Рік тому

      @@michaelseebass It's not a fixed effects chain. The blocks are configurable but there is only a single chain where the Helix and Stomp have 2 chains.

    • @ericvandruten
      @ericvandruten 10 місяців тому

      The stomp XL is the Stomp's big brother. The Pod Go has less fx power, (2 fx blocks less than the Stomp / Stomp XL). It does have 4 snapshots per preset though, like the Stomp XL. The Stomp has three snapshots per preset.
      the Pod Go is really about ease of use, with the in-built expression pedal and wireless (accepting the other Line 6 beltpacks too). Put it on the floor, switch on and play.

    Hey, can I set two outputs in the stomp ? one for DI and other to go through an amp?

    • @michaelseebass
      @michaelseebass  Рік тому +1

      You mean using the left main out and right main out separately for that? Not sure but my guess would be yes it's probably possible. You would split your chain and just have the amp on one of them and then assign different outputs at the end of the split chain. But I would have to test this to make sure, so please don't rely on it, it's just my guess right now

    • @ericvandruten
      @ericvandruten 10 місяців тому +1

      yes, that's possible. You can split the signal chain, and put a cab sim / IR on one chain, and direct that to your DI path. the other one can then go to the amp (fx return)
      The Pod Go has a separate output for amp, so one amp and 2 main outs.

    • @cacacoco2
      @cacacoco2 10 місяців тому

      @@ericvandruten DI signal goes through the Send output in the Hx Stomp?

    • @ericvandruten
      @ericvandruten 10 місяців тому +1

      @@cacacoco2 nope. Create an A + B path in the fx chain. Pan A to left, B to right. Send the left output to your amp return.
      Put an IR or cab sim in the B path. Send R Output to FOH.
